| 3.2 | Aroma | Appearance | Flavor | Palate | Overall | | 5/10 | 2/5 | 7/10 | 4/5 | 14/20 | Jan 16, 2005 Pale gold colour. A bit cloudy. Some grassy hop in the aroma, but much more restrained than I had been expecting. A hint of sulphur too. The hop character comes through much more clearly on the palate. Clean, crisp and citric. Not a lot of bitterness, with some fruitiness coming through on the finish. A light bodied, refreshing beer, but nothing out of the ordinary in my view. Cask (handpump) at Chelmsford Winter Beer Festival 2005.
